WebJan 26, 2024 · In some cases, when a dog’s nails grow out too long, they will start to curl back in around the paw. When they reach a long enough length, the nails may actually pierce the paw pads and continue growing into your dog’s paw, creating constant pain and an increased risk of infection. This is most common with the dewclaw. WebMay 10, 2024 · Technically an overgrowth of keratin tissue, usually associated with the pads of the toes. WebNov 7, 2024 · Paw pad hyperkeratosis refers to when thickened skin or extra skin grows on your dog's paw. The skin's appearance may vary, but it often resembles thick hair on your dog's paw pads. Thus, it's often called "hairy feet". Hyperkeratosis occurs due to a protein inside your dog called keratin. Your dog's body can make too much keratin on … WebMar 4, 2024 · 9. Web4. Hold your Dog’s Paw: Hold your dog’s paw firmly but gently and spread the toes apart to identify the beyond-grown nails. 5. Trim the Nail: Using the nail clipper, cut a small part of the nail that is beyond the paw, avoiding the quick. If you see a white ring within the nail, stop trimming immediately as it is close to the quick.
